Wraprascal (n.)
A kind of coarse upper coat, or overcoat, formerly worn.
of Wrap
Wrasse (n.)
Any one of numerous edible, marine, spiny-finned fishes of the genus Labrus, of which several species are found in the Mediterranean and on the Atlantic coast of Europe. Many of the species are bright-colored.
Wrastle (v. i.)
To wrestle.
Wrath (a.)
Violent anger; vehement exasperation; indignation; rage; fury; ire.
Wrath (a.)
The effects of anger or indignation; the just punishment of an offense or a crime.
Wrath (a.)
See Wroth.
Wrath (v. t.)
To anger; to enrage; -- also used impersonally.
Wrathful (a.)
Full of wrath; very angry; greatly incensed; ireful; passionate; as, a wrathful man.
Wrathful (a.)
Springing from, or expressing, wrath; as, a wrathful countenance.
Wrathily (adv.)
In a wrathy manner; very angrily; wrathfully.
Wrathless (a.)
Free from anger or wrath.
Wrathy (a.)
Very angry.
Wraw (a.)
Angry; vexed; wrathful.
Wrawful (a.)
Ill-tempered.
Wrawl (v. i.)
To cry, as a cat; to waul.
Wrawness (n.)
Peevishness; ill temper; anger.
Wray (v. t.)
To reveal; to disclose.
Wreak (v. i.)
To reck; to care.
Wreak (v. t.)
To revenge; to avenge.
